    After the huge success of Reincarnated, the station followed up in 1979 with another popular period piece Dragon Strikes, again written by novelist Huang Yi and screenwriter Kong Lung. Set in the Ming Dynasty, Dragon Strikes follows swordsman Xiao Yiu Hau and the dangerous power struggle and tangle of corruption and conspiracies he encounters in the royal court and the martial arts world. The power struggle is evident both in the palace as well as in the martial arts world. This series focused on that of the 3 big clans with the Siu Yiu clan, Pai Ling clan, and the South Gate clan. Rivalry and politics of the palace mixed with the martial arts world make this a martial arts extravaganza!

    When Easterly Showers Fall on the Sunny West (Traditional Chinese: 東山飄雨西關晴) is a Hong Kong TVB period drama series broadcasting from October till December 2008. Story takes place in the early 1930s in the city of Guangzhou (China) and revolved around the rich and prestigious Poon family. TVB's poetically titled 2008 anniversary drama When Easterly Showers Fall on the Sunny West sets the stage for family struggle, romantic conflict, and financial strife in the turbulence of early 20th century China. Veteran actress Liza Wang leads the cast of this 30-episode grand drama, along with top TVB stars Joe Ma and Charmaine Sheh as the story's fated couple. The cast includes new-generation stars Raymond Wong, Edwin Siu, Natalie Tong, Selena Li, and Zac Kao as well as character actors Evergreen Mak, Cheung Kwok Keung, Kiki Sheung, amd Kwok Fung. In her youth, Poon clan matron Fung Yee (Liza Wang) abandoned her baby son to hide the stigma of giving birth out of wedlock. Years later, her son Hing (Joe Ma) has grown up through tough circumstances, and ends up working as a chauffeur for the Poon family after saving his brother Wah (Raymond Wong) by chance. When Hing's identity is revealed, his status as Poon family's eldest son is restored, throwing the family into a state of turbulent ambivalence. Wah's relationship with poor girl Ching (Charmaine Sheh) also heads for the rocks because of his mother's disapproval, but Hing grows closer to Ching while helping her set up her own shop. When the Poons hit on difficult times, Hing steps up to save the family business, starting off a new round of conflict and power struggle.     No matter how you look at him, Shibata Taketora is just a quiet, ordinary junior high student. He looks so vulnerable that bullies try to rip him off on the streets, but he is actually a police detective and an expert swordsman in kendo. Taketora has a special ability to see the "hands of death" around people whose life is nearing the end. One day, Taketora is assigned on undercover operations. He sneaks into a high school, a maid cafe and a juvenile detention center... With the cooperation from his various friends, he gets to the bottom of the matters

    High school student Hoshi Izumi (Nagasawa Masami) loses her father suddenly in an accident. One day, Sakuma (Tsutsumi Shinichi), the waka gashira of a small and weak Yakuza gang in Asakusa – the Medaka Gumi – pays Izumi a visit along with the gang members. The death of their former kumicho (Boss) puts Medaka Gumi on the verge of a breakup. Therefore, Sakuma begs Izumi, the former boss's only distant relative left, to succeed to the kumicho position. Izumi is taken by surprise and keeps refusing at first. However, she ends up becoming the 8th kumicho of the Medaka Gumi! The police tell her that her father's death may possibly be a homicide case. There's also Mayumi (Koizumi Kyoko), a mysterious woman staring closely at Izumi's father's photograph at his funeral. The situation becomes complicated when the drug-dealing vicious yakuza, Hamaguchi Gumi, comes into the picture as well as Sandaiji Hajime (Ogata Ken), a politician whose public stance is to eliminate drugs. --TBS

    The Board of Audit’s Special Investigations Division punishes civil servants who cheat and waste the taxes paid by the hard-working people. The heroine, Shinko, is a daring character who doesn't get impressed by power and influence but mercilessly pursues the scoundrels. She who used to be a swindler and has a difficult personality gets scouted by the division and is paired up with the elite rookie, Kudo who is a graduate of Tokyo University and comes from a family of government officials.
